Prime Focus Art Director Salaries in Utica, NY

The average Prime Focus Art Director in Utica, NY earns an estimated $113,912 annually. Prime Focus' Art Director compensation is $16,485 more than the US average for a Art Director.

In Utica, NY, The Design Department at Prime Focus earns $1,230 more on average than the HR Department.
